Regular maintenance, performed by trained professionals, is not merely a recommendation; it’s an imperative. This includes everything from cleaning dust and debris from your mining rigs to ensuring optimal cooling system performance and identifying potential hardware failures before they occur. Proactive maintenance translates directly into increased uptime, enhanced hash rates, and, ultimately, higher profitability. Beyond the nuts and bolts of hardware maintenance lies the strategic decision of where to house your mining operation. Running a small-scale mining operation from your basement might seem appealing at first, but it quickly becomes unsustainable as your ambitions (and electricity bills) grow. This is where mining hosting solutions come into play. Reputable hosting providers offer purpose-built facilities designed to optimize mining performance. These facilities boast features such as industrial-grade cooling systems, redundant power supplies, and robust security measures, creating an environment where your mining rigs can operate at peak efficiency, 24/7.
The scalability offered by these hosting solutions is another key advantage. As the price of Bitcoin or Ethereum fluctuates, or as you identify new and promising cryptocurrencies to mine, you need the ability to rapidly expand or contract your mining capacity. Hosting providers allow you to do just that, scaling your operation up or down as market conditions dictate. This flexibility is particularly valuable in the volatile world of crypto, where fortunes can be made (or lost) in a matter of days. Imagine trying to add ten more mining rigs to your basement setup overnight – a logistical nightmare! With a scalable hosting solution, it’s simply a matter of contacting your provider and requesting the additional capacity.
Choosing the right hosting provider is paramount. Consider factors such as the provider’s experience, reputation, security protocols, power costs, and proximity to reliable power grids. Look for providers who offer transparent pricing and comprehensive service level agreements (SLAs) that guarantee uptime and performance. Furthermore, consider the environmental impact. Mining cryptocurrencies, especially those relying on Proof-of-Work consensus mechanisms like Bitcoin, can be energy-intensive. Many hosting providers are now prioritizing sustainable energy sources, such as solar and wind power, to reduce the carbon footprint of their operations. Choosing a hosting provider committed to sustainability not only benefits the environment but can also enhance your company’s reputation and appeal to environmentally conscious investors.
